Excretion in Hydra occurs primarily through the process of diffusion, as these simple organisms lack specialized excretory structures. Waste products, including nitrogenous wastes, diffuse directly from the cells into the surrounding water, which is isotonic to their internal environment. This method of excretion is efficient for Hydra, as they inhabit aquatic environments where waste can easily disperse. Additionally, the constant flow of water through their body aids in the removal of metabolic wastes, ensuring that toxic substances do not accumulate
What is the primary method of excretion in Hydra?
The primary method of excretion in Hydra is diffusion, as they lack specialized excretory structures
What types of waste products do Hydra excrete?
Hydra excrete nitrogenous wastes, primarily in the form of ammonia, along with other metabolic wastes
How does the surrounding environment affect the excretion process in Hydra?
Hydra live in isotonic aquatic environments, allowing waste products to diffuse easily into the surrounding water
Why is diffusion an effective method of excretion for Hydra?
Diffusion is effective for Hydra because they are small and live in water, where waste can disperse quickly, preventing toxic accumulation
What role does water play in the excretion process of Hydra?
Water facilitates the removal of metabolic wastes by providing a medium for diffusion and helping to maintain osmotic balance
